Default TV quality -- help needed

I am wanting (of course) to get the absolute best quality out of MediaPortal to my TV. My TV LCD resolution is 1360x768 and I have my PC desktop set to match that. When Playing DVDs the picture quality is very good, for video files it depends on the video itself but the better videos play excellant. My one "sore-spot" is with TV display. on "actual" display size of 640x480 the pic looks very good on the TV, however when playing any of the "zoomed" modes including "normal" (which I normally watch) the picture is visible inferior to the TV's own output of the same channel (same cable source) in the same expanded mode. The TV just does a MUCH better job of upscaling the SD channels than the MediaPortal does.

Even though the Theater550 may be lacking some setting options, "supposedly" it is (or was a year ago anyways) the best TV card on the market for quality picture. and the ATI 9800pro (again at least it was 2years ago when purchased) was arguably the best video card on the market . I just cant believe that between the video card, the TV card, codec choice, and MediaPortal settings I cant get a TV output that at least compares favorably with the Toshiba's own upscaling of SD material. It is a very watchable picture for sure, I just feel it could be better on upscaled SD signals.

yeah I know I am alwasy gonna lose some quality when upscaling SD TV from 640x480 to 1024x768, I just want it to be better than it is now...

Any and all assistance in improving my TV Out is definitely appreciated.
